Higher Level Teaching Assistant
We would like to appoint a dedicated, flexible, skilled Higher Level Teaching Assistant to work across the school from May 2026.
Actual Salary: £20,069-£21,238
We need an HLTA who:
- Is an outstanding classroom practitioner with a proven track record
- Is committed to high standards of attainment and behaviour
- Has a flexible and supportive approach to changing demands
- Works effectively as part of a skilled team
- Is able to plan, prepare and assess own lessons
- Has appropriate qualifications and experience
The post will include whole class teaching for PPA cover (including teaching PE, computing and Foundation subjects) and may involve teaching intervention groups in literacy, (including RWI phonics, reading and writing) and mathematics. It will also include working in class to support the teaching staff. The role will also involve providing cover at short notice across the school.
